How much do senior customer insight analyst jobs pay per year?

As of Jul 3, 2026, the average yearly pay for senior customer insight analyst in Wisconsin is $103,486.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$88,800.00 and $117,600.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does a Senior Customer Insight Analyst do?

A Senior Customer Insight Analyst is responsible for analyzing customer data to identify trends, behaviors, and preferences. They use advanced analytical techniques to transform raw data into actionable insights that help businesses make informed decisions about products, services, and marketing strategies. Their work often involves collaborating with various departments to provide recommendations that improve customer experience and drive business growth. Senior analysts typically lead projects, mentor junior team members, and present findings to stakeholders.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Senior Customer Insight Analyst,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Senior Customer Insight Analyst, you need strong analytical skills, proficiency in statistical analysis, and a background in marketing, business, or a related field. Familiarity with data visualization tools (such as Tableau or Power BI), statistical software (like SPSS or R), and CRM systems is typically required. Exceptional communication, critical thinking, and stakeholder management skills help translate complex data into actionable business insights. These capabilities are essential for driving data-informed decision-making and delivering customer-focused strategies that support organizational growth.

Job Summary
This position has primary responsibility for leading customer experience and customer satisfaction research efforts for both residential and business customers. Individuals in this position will work collaboratively with leadership and internal stakeholders to develop strategic and tactical approaches to drive improvements towards achieving the corporate customer satisfaction goals. They will identify research objectives and conduct analyses of the data to provide actionable insights and recommendations. These individual(s) will make presentations to communicate their findings to leadership and others in the organization. These individual(s) will prepare reports on customer satisfaction goal progress for senior leadership.
Job Responsibilities
  • Manage daily operations of the corporate-wide customer satisfaction transaction survey process
  • Provide accurate and timely reports on customer satisfaction goal progress to leadership and the WEC Board of Directors
  • Support the development and rollout of annual corporate customer satisfaction goals
  • Identify actionable insights using statistical analysis and text/sentiment analysis
  • Lead action planning meetings with internal stakeholders
  • Foster relationships with internal stakeholders to understand their business and meet their needs
  • Create and deliver presentations to a wide variety of audiences, including senior leadership
  • Manage residential customer online panel and lead panel research that drives business value and customer satisfaction
  • Identify and promote best practices by leveraging insights from peer utilities, industry benchmark studies and vendor partnerships
  • Manage customer outreach and recovery programs to enhance communication and customer satisfaction
  • Provide custom research in support of various corporate initiatives including employee experience
  • Lead vendor relationships; may formally supervise employees
  • Assist with budget development and oversight

Minimum Qualifications
  • Bachelor's degree in business, data analytics, economics, computer science, statistics, mathematics, marketing, social sciences, or related discipline
  • Minimum 2+ years (Specialist), 5+ years (Senior), or 8+ years (Principal) experience in market research (customer satisfaction research, survey research) or data analytics related
  • Demonstrated ability to use market research techniques (quantitative and qualitative)
  • Knowledge of statistical analysis software such as SAS, SPSS, Power BI, and/or R
  • Demonstrated project management and meeting facilitation skills
  • Excellent professional communication skills, both written and verbal
  • Demonstrated experience providing recommendations that produced positive business outcomes
  • Proficiency with Microsoft Office Suite (highly competent in Excel and PowerPoint)

Preferred Qualifications
  • 5+ years relevant work experience
  • Advanced Degree beyond a Bachelors Degree
  • Candidates with research experience in other industries or fields (e.g., marketing, social science, etc.) are encouraged to apply
  • End-to-end research study management from study design and survey creation to data analysis and results presentation
